ATXN2L
Function
Involved in the regulation of stress granule and P-body formation.
Post-translational modifications
Thrombopoietin triggers the phosphorylation on tyrosine residues in a way that is dependent on MPL C-terminal domain.
Asymmetrically dimethylated. Probably methylated by PRMT1.
Sequence Similarities
Belongs to the ataxin-2 family.
Tissue Specificity
Expressed at high levels in thymus, lymph node, spleen, fetal kidney and adult testis. Constitutively associated with MPL and EPOR in hematopoietic cells.
Cellular localization
- Membrane
- Peripheral membrane protein
- Cytoplasm
- Nucleus speckle
- Cytoplasmic granule
- Predominantly cytoplasmic but is also detected in nuclear speckles (PubMed:23209657). Component of cytoplasmic stress granules (PubMed:23209657). Inhibition of methylation alters nuclear localization (PubMed:25748791). Methylation does not seem to be required for localization to stress granules under stress conditions (PubMed:25748791).
